54:13 you see how much more rigid WST judging is to SLS YUMEKA got 8.5 for her crook nollie flip here. Whereas in WST Tokyo they gave her I think 70 because they are so overly rigid with scoring based on obstacle size So you will never see flip in flip out on a small ledge or Hubba in the Olympics because of the scoring. In WST qualifiers or Olympics you can get 80 minimum for doing a smith or feeble on the biggest rail. But a kickflip tail slide on a small ledge will get you less than that. Certainly something like a flip in flip out will not even get 90 tbh if it’s on a ledge at WST so you’ll never see it
